CDN加速动态请求,即利用内容分发网络(CDN)技术对动态生成的内容进行加速传输和缓存,传统的CDN主要用于加速静态资源,如图片、视频等,而动态请求则是指根据用户的个性化需求或特定的请求参数,动态生成的内容,比如动态网页、动态数据等,下面将详细探讨CDN加速动态请求的各个方面:
CDN加速动态请求的原理
原理/特点 | 描述 |
智能路由选择 | CDN通过动态加速技术智能选择较优路由回源获取动态内容。 |
避开网络拥堵 | 动态加速能够有效避开网络拥堵路由,提高访问成功率。 |
实时优化加载速度 | 通过动态加速技术,可以有效提升动态页面的加载速度。 |
CDN动态加速的优势
优势 | 描述 |
提高访问速度 | 动态加速可以显著提高用户访问动态内容的速率,改善用户体验。 |
增加访问成功率 | 通过避开网络拥堵,动态加速能够确保更高的访问成功率。 |
减轻源站压力 | 动态内容的分发和缓存减轻了源站服务器的负担,提高了网站的稳定性。 |
CDN动态加速的应用场景
场景 | 描述 |
电商平台 | 大型电商平台在促销期间面临大流量访问,动态加速可以保证商品信息的快速加载和更新。 |
金融行业 | 金融行业需要实时更新股票、汇率等信息,动态加速有助于提供即时数据。 |
新闻网站 | 新闻网站需要频繁更新内容,动态加速可以确保用户快速获取最新资讯。 |
全站加速与动态加速的关系
关系 | 描述 |
动静态结合 | 全站加速DCDN提供动静态加速,包括动态内容的加速。 |
安全防护 | 在加速的同时,还支持边缘大流量DDoS攻击清洗与Web应用防火墙防护。 |
边缘计算 | 可通过边缘程序将应用和服务快速部署到全球边缘节点上。 |
CDN动态加速的技术实现
技术实现 | 描述 |
智能路由选择 | CDN会根据网络状况和用户位置选择最优的路由来获取和传输动态内容。 |
边缘计算 | 利用边缘计算技术,动态内容可以在接近用户的地点生成和缓存,减少延迟。 |
TCP/UDP四层加速 | 提供传输层的加速服务,优化数据传输效率。 |
CDN动态加速的市场趋势
趋势 | 描述 |
AI驱动优化 | 随着人工智能技术的发展,CDN动态加速将更加智能化,能够预测和响应网络变化。 |
安全性增强 | 安全问题日益重要,未来的CDN动态加速将更加注重安全性,提供更多保护措施。 |
个性化定制 | 根据不同行业和业务需求,提供更加个性化的动态加速解决方案。 |
归纳而言,CDN加速动态请求是现代网络内容分发的重要组成部分,它通过智能路由选择、边缘计算等技术实现动态内容的快速加载和传输,动态加速不仅提高了网站的访问速度和成功率,还为源站减压,提供了更好的用户体验,随着技术的不断进步,CDN动态加速将更加智能化、安全化和个性化,满足不断变化的网络需求。
下面是一个简化的介绍,描述了CDN加速动态请求的动态加速相关要点:
加速步骤 | 描述 |
静态化 | 将动态内容(如数据库查询结果、后端处理逻辑)转化为静态内容,通常通过缓存实现。 |
缓存 | 在全球多个CDN节点上存储静态内容,根据用户地理位置选择最近的节点提供服务。 |
动态加速 | 对于无法静态化的动态请求,CDN转发给源站处理,并缓存返回结果,减轻源站负载。 |
智能路由 | CDN根据用户IP地址、网络状况和节点负载,智能选择最优节点处理请求。 |
带宽优化 | 通过压缩技术和数据分发算法,降低数据传输成本,提升访问速度。 |
负载均衡 | 动态分配用户请求到不同的服务器,合理利用资源,提高网站性能和可用性。 |
故障恢复 | 在服务器发生故障时,自动将请求切换到其他可用服务器,保证服务连续性。 |
这个介绍概括了CDN在处理动态请求时的关键加速技术,通过这些技术手段,CDN能够显著提升动态网站的性能和用户体验。